How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bethesda?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Bethesda Gated Studio Apartments | $1,863 | $1,100 | $3,647 |
| Bethesda Gated 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,526 | $1,197 | $5,336 |
| Bethesda Gated 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,943 | $1,499 | $10,000+ |
| Bethesda Gated 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,946 | $2,300 | $10,000+ |
| Bethesda Gated 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,000 | $5,000 | $5,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gated Bethesda Apartments
What is the Cheapest Gated apartment in Bethesda?
Currently the most affordable Gated Apartment in Bethesda is at 4107 Connecticut Avenue listed at $1,100.
How much is the average rent for a Gated Bethesda Apartment?
The average rent for a Gated Apartment in Bethesda is $3,719.
What is the largest Gated Bethesda Apartment for rent?
Today's Gated apartment with the most square footage in Bethesda is a 4,150 square feet unit starting from $1,823 at The Grand.
What is the average size for Bethesda Gated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Gated rental in Bethesda is currently at 566 sq ft.
